When Progress Becomes Erasure.
In the remote glens of Scotland, a quiet war is unfolding.
For centuries, rural families—keepers, stalkers, ghillies, and crofters—have lived and worked on the land. They’ve shaped it, protected it, passed it down. Today, they’re being erased.
Urban politicians, distant corporations chasing carbon credits, and rewilding activists with no stake in the land have a different vision: remove the people, let nature reclaim itself. But for those still clinging to the soil, this isn’t conservation—it’s displacement dressed as progress.
What happens when centuries of knowledge are pushed aside in favor of policy built in cities?
